For the eye makeup, I went with something equally as vampy, but nothing overly dramatic. I specifically lined both the top lash-line and the lower water-line so that my eye color popped. I patted a light grey eyeshadow over my entire eyelid and along my lower lash-line. I love the way the eyeliner around the entire eye looks with a dark lip. As long as you keep the cheek color neutral, you can indeed play up both your eyes and your lips at the same time.

For the lips, I outlined them with a dark brown lip pencil first. This is an important step when using a really dark, dramatic lip color like this one. It helps you to shape your lips perfectly before filling them in with the lipstick and also helps prevent feathering. After I lined them, I applied the lipstick straight from the tube. This lipstick is super pigmented, so one coat was more than enough to put down great color. If you have to, go back and clean up any edges with a small brush and concealer. Often times with lip shades this dark, you will need to clean up little mistakes around the edges. You want a super crisp lip line.

For the face, the simpler the better. You want the skin to be as perfected as possible. I used medium coverage foundation and concealer to get rid of any redness or blemishes. I contoured my face and used a neutral brown blush on the apples of my cheeks. The face makeup should not compete with the lips and eyes here, so neutral is what works!
